An exciting opportunity to work in a fast-paced, growing organisation as a Skilled Machinist within the Transmissions Operations UK is available.
If you have an Apprenticeship NVQ level 3 (inclusive for anyone pre 1990 and post 1990), please read on; if you apply, make sure you upload your qualifications to be considered for the role.
Job Scope:
As a Skilled Machinist, you will have diverse abilities to operate manual and CNC machinery with knowledge and experience of various machining operations, including turning, boring, grinding, milling, shaping, and drilling. You will join a large team working across Transmission component machining facilities.

WHAT WE ARE LOOKING FOR
An engineering apprenticeship and NVQ level 3 Mechanical Engineering qualifications as a minimum.
Skills biased towards manual machining.
Familiarity with Siemens / Fanuc machinery control systems, including legacy systems like Siemens Sinumerik System 3.
Ability to work independently and contribute to team efforts.

Life at Leonardo
With a company-funded benefits package, a commitment to learning and development, and flexible working hours, a career with Leonardo offers many opportunities.
Flexible Working: Hybrid options available. Part-time opportunities available upon discussion.
Company-funded benefits: Private healthcare, dental schemes, Workplace ISA, Go Green Car Scheme, technology and lifestyle allowances (£500/year).
Holidays: 25 days plus bank holidays, with options to buy/sell leave and accrue up to 12 additional flexi days annually.
Pension: Up to 15% employer contribution.
Wellbeing: Employee Assistance Programme, mental health support, financial wellbeing resources, and diversity & inclusion networks.
Lifestyle: Discounted gym memberships, Cycle to Work scheme.
Training: Access to over 4000 online courses via Coursera and LinkedIn Learning.
Referral Incentive: Rewards for referring friends or family.
Bonus: Scheme for all employees at management level and below.
